Tried everything and you don't know what to do?
Less mainstream but nonetheless with high levels of success for patients suffering chronic pain from RSI are MindBody Syndrome Treatment and Alexander Technique.
MindBody, also known as TMS, is very low cost as it can be done at home in a self treatment way from books or audio books. Alexander Technique requires a trained Alexander Technique practitioner to observer and coach you through a period of treatment.
